Hello, I'm Jayasurya Aasaithambi

I am a Unity Developer with 3 years of experience in game and AR/VR development in the industry. I have extensive experience in developing, testing and optimizing games, immersive experiences and tools. My biggest strength is writing reusable codes and components in Unity. I'm a quick learner and can work well both independently and as part of a team. I am an excellent communicator and have been able to effectively collaborate with designers, artists and product owners to ensure the final product meets all requirements and exceeds expectations. I am eager to bring my expertise and passion for game development to a new challenge.

Feb 2021 - PRESENT
Unity Developer & Instructor at VyVoxel

I've been developing innovative and engaging virtual and augmented reality experiences. I have worked on a variety of AR/VR projects, from educational experiences that bring learning to life, to immersive gaming experiences that transport players to new worlds. I've mentored over 20+ students and have trained them in Designing and Developing games, and AR/VR experiences.

Feb 2020 - Jan 2021
Unity Instructor at Image

I was teaching and training individuals in the use of Unity and its related technologies. Worked with students of all ages and skill levels, helping them to gain a solid understanding of Unity and its capabilities. Developed educational materials, including lesson plans, assignments, and interactive activities that make learning fun and engaging.

Nov 2018 - Jan 2020
Unity Developer at Codeneuron

Developed and delivered successful Unity projects for clients. Worked on a variety of projects, from small games and interactive experiences to larger projects that require detailed planning and collaboration with designers, artists, and producers.

Skills

Below are my primary skills

Unity Game Engine

Unity is a powerful cross-platform game engine used for the development of 2D and 3D games and interactive experiences. I've been using unity for more than 6 years. It has never stopped to amaze me with every update how easier it gets to create stunning visuals and experiences.

C#

C# is a modern, object-oriented programming language developed by Microsoft. It is widely used for developing Windows desktop applications, games, and web applications. It is known for its strong type system, automatic memory management, and modern programming paradigms. C# has been my primary programming language even since I decided to use Unity as my primary game engine.

Tools & Unity Package Development

Tools and Packgae development in Unity refers to the process of creating editor tools to support or improve the performance of the game/experience development process. I have personally loved Unity's Component System and have created a lot of reusable components. Utilising the Scriptable Objects and The Editor Scripting in Unity, I have developed simple but effect systems that improve the production pace of white-lable application.

Why Work With Me

I am a great communicator and love to work along with the team to achieve fast and high quality results. I invest the necessary time to understand the customer's problem to provide the best solutions.

Game Engines

My favorite Engine is Unity but I can also create AR and VR Experiences in Unreal.

Programming Language

My favorite Programming Languages are C#, C++ and JavaScript but I can also program in Java, Swift and Python too.

alternative alternative alternative alternative alternative alternative

Latest Projects

Listed below are some of the most resent projects I've worked on.

Project: Vy Experience - AR Application with multiple features.

Project: Web AR Demo - Placing 3D Object using Plan Tracking.

Project: VR Training Simulation - Assemble a v8 Car Engine in Virtual Reality.

Project: Car Customizer - Switch color for the car body and wheels.

Project: All my old works